The U.S. Justice Department has launched a criminal investigation into E. Jean Carroll, the former magazine columnist who accused President Donald Trump of sexual assault in the mid-1990s, according to reports on Wednesday. The probe, which is being led by the U.S. Attorney’s Office for the Northern District of Illinois in Chicago, is focused on whether Carroll committed perjury in testimony tied to her two successful civil lawsuits against the president. This development marks a significant legal escalation by the Justice Department against a high-profile accuser who previously prevailed against Trump in civil court.

此次刑事调查的核心在于卡罗尔关于其诉讼资金来源的陈述。检察官的理论依据是卡罗尔在2022年的一份宣誓证词,当时现年82岁的卡罗尔声称她没有为自己的诉讼接受任何外部资金。然而,随后的信息披露显示,领英(LinkedIn)联合创始人、亿万富翁里德·霍夫曼(Reid Hoffman)曾为她的法律行动提供过资助。司法部的介入引发了广泛关注,因为卡罗尔被视为特朗普的长期法律对手,而《纽约时报》等媒体指出,她已成为司法部针对特朗普“感知到的敌人”行动中的最新目标。

The core of the criminal inquiry hinges on Carroll’s statements regarding the financing of her legal battles. Prosecutors are reportedly focusing on a 2022 deposition in which Carroll, 82, stated under oath that she had received no outside funding for her lawsuits. This claim was later challenged by revelations that billionaire Reid Hoffman, the co-founder of LinkedIn, had provided financial backing for her legal efforts. The Justice Department's intervention has drawn intense scrutiny, as Carroll remains a prominent legal adversary of Trump, with outlets like the New York Times characterizing her as the latest target in a campaign directed at the president's perceived enemies.

The Justice Department's investigation is specifically targeting the veracity of Carroll's testimony during her civil litigation. Prosecutors are examining her 2022 statements concerning the costs of her lawsuits. Although Carroll was successful in her civil claims, any proof that she intentionally misled the court regarding her financial backing could lead to serious criminal consequences. The probe is being handled by the U.S. Attorney’s Office in Chicago, moving the matter outside the New York court system where the original civil cases were heard.

Carroll previously filed two civil lawsuits against Trump. The first involved her 2019 accusation that Trump sexually assaulted her in a New York department store dressing room in the 1990s; the second addressed defamatory comments Trump made during and after his presidency. In 2023, a New York jury found Trump liable for sexual abuse and defamation, awarding Carroll significant damages. While Trump has consistently denied all allegations, these civil verdicts were initially seen as major legal victories for Carroll.

The Justice Department's investigation remains in its early stages. Legal experts note that the opening of a criminal inquiry does not guarantee that Carroll will ultimately face charges. Prosecutors must prove that Carroll not only provided incorrect information in her testimony but did so with the specific intent to deceive. Furthermore, because the case involves a political adversary and accuser of the current president, the impartiality of the probe is being closely watched by media and legal observers. Should charges be filed, it could have complex implications for the civil judgments Carroll previously secured.
